Transaction f87660eb98bed4a4264462612e44867520b1a8043a3de0c988d22301b5bfb99d
1 Input
1 Output
-
f87660eb98bed4a4264462612e44867520b1a8043a3de0c988d22301b5bfb99d:0
- value
- 44199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7cd84e2634338de27f6a5cc996d8a86e98f44104 OP_EQUAL
- address
- 3D58qV3kxw115QyNtg7CZvx4Wvgodx8ss1